The heated mandrel winding method is a new process based on the internal heat-curing method. With the advantages of high production efficiency, good pressure resistance, and so on, the thermosetting fiber composite shell produced using the heated mandrel winding method has been used as a high-pressure shell.
The heating mandrel market is witnessing a trend towards increased adoption in various industries such as automotive, aerospace, electronics, and oil and gas. One of the main drivers for this trend is the growing demand for advanced manufacturing processes, which require precise and consistent heating of materials. Heating mandrels offer a reliable and efficient solution for shaping and forming various components, such as pipes, tubes, and cables.
